The table below provides summary statistics and contractor rates for jobs requiring Argo skills. It covers contract job vacancies from the 6 months leading up to 2 July 2026, with comparisons to the same periods in the previous two years.

6 months to
2 Jul 2026
Same period 2025 Same period 2024
Rank 491 475 536
Rank change year-on-year -16 +61 +97
Contract jobs citing Argo 164 61 51
As % of all contract jobs in the UK 0.32% 0.20% 0.12%
As % of the Systems Management category 2.37% 1.25% 0.95%
Number of daily rates quoted 73 40 36
10th Percentile £400 £459 £438
25th Percentile £504 £500 £461
Median daily rate (50th Percentile) £525 £555 £497
Median % change year-on-year -5.41% +11.78% -25.56%
75th Percentile £613 £625 £548
90th Percentile £686 £675 £649
UK excluding London median daily rate £519 £500 £497
% change year-on-year +3.80% +0.70% -25.34%
